A Poem by Anonymous

Writing you poems
like throwing coins
in fountains.
Miracles happen.
I'm silently shouting.
it's against the law -
but if love is a card game -
I'm counting
down to the day when I'm
no longer upholding your crown,
blowing dust off your shoulders
making sure my touch
doesn't get you any colder.
Everybody says
I'm too straightforward.
I'd say more forward than straight,
apparently,
not even once was it a date.
Just friends sipping wine
exchanging tipsy sexy vibes
painting colorful pictures
of us
under the stars
talking till it's no longer dark
we got our thighs interacting
my stomach drops.
I swear I'm listening
it's not distracting.
You said you'll meet
your love in 2016
I'm here,
waiting to be seen.
I swear I'll quit,
just another hit.
Miracles happen -
I'm silently shouting. 
 - to M.A.
